DNS 电信西安:原理、应用与优化策略
一、引言
在当今数字化时代,网络通信的顺畅运行离不开 DNS(域名系统)的支持,对于西安地区的电信网络而言,DNS 更是起着至关重要的作用,它如同网络世界的“导航仪”,将用户输入的域名转换为计算机能够识别的 IP 地址,从而实现各种网络资源的访问。
二、DNS 基础概念
概念名称 | 解释 |
域名 | 由一串字符组成的互联网标识符,用于标识特定的网站或网络服务,如“www.example.com”,它具有层次结构,从右到左依次为顶级域名、二级域名等。 |
IP 地址 | 互联网中设备的数字标识,分为 IPv4 和 IPv6 两种格式,IPv4 由 32 位二进制数组成,通常用点分十进制表示,如“192.168.1.1”;IPv6 则采用 128 位二进制数,具有更大的地址空间,如“2001:0db8:85a3:0000:0000:8a2e:0370:7334”。 |
DNS 服务器 | 存储域名与 IP 地址对应关系的计算机系统,当用户查询某个域名时,DNS 服务器负责返回该域名所对应的 IP 地址,常见的 DNS 服务器包括根 DNS 服务器、顶级域名 DNS 服务器、权威 DNS 服务器和本地 DNS 服务器等。 |
三、西安电信 DNS 的重要性
(一)提高网络访问速度
西安电信 DNS 服务器通常部署在本地网络中,相比于一些远程的 DNS 服务器,具有更低的网络延迟,当用户访问本地或国内的网络资源时,通过西安电信 DNS 解析,可以更快地获取到目标 IP 地址,从而加速网页加载、文件下载等网络操作,提升用户的上网体验,访问西安本地的新闻网站或政府机构网站,使用本地 DNS 可能只需几毫秒就能完成解析,而使用其他地区的 DNS 可能需要几十毫秒甚至更长时间。
(二)保障网络安全
西安电信 DNS 可以对域名解析过程进行安全监测和过滤,它能够识别并拦截一些恶意域名,如钓鱼网站、病毒传播站点等,防止用户误访问这些危险网站而导致个人信息泄露或遭受网络攻击,通过对 DNS 请求的流量分析,还可以发现异常的网络活动,及时采取安全防护措施,保障西安地区电信网络的安全稳定运行。
(三)支持本地业务发展
对于西安地区的企业和个人网站而言,使用西安电信 DNS 有利于本地业务的推广和发展,本地 DNS 服务器能够更好地服务于本地用户,确保本地网站在西安地区的访问稳定性和速度,提高本地网站的竞争力,西安电信还可以根据本地市场需求,提供个性化的 DNS 服务解决方案,满足不同行业用户的特定需求,促进西安地区互联网产业的繁荣。
四、西安电信 DNS 的工作原理
(一)域名解析流程
1、用户发起查询:当用户在浏览器中输入一个域名(如“www.xanews.com”)后,浏览器首先向本地配置的首选 DNS 服务器发送域名解析请求。
2、本地 DNS 缓存查询:本地 DNS 服务器首先会在自己的缓存中查找该域名是否已经解析过,如果缓存中有对应的 IP 地址记录,则直接将结果返回给用户浏览器,解析过程结束。
3、递归查询或迭代查询
递归查询:如果本地 DNS 服务器缓存中没有该域名的记录,它会代表客户端向其他 DNS 服务器进行完全解析查询,直到获得最终的 IP 地址为止,在这个过程中,本地 DNS 服务器可能会依次向根 DNS 服务器、顶级域名 DNS 服务器、权威 DNS 服务器进行查询,直到得到答案后返回给客户端。
迭代查询:与递归查询不同的是,本地 DNS 服务器在迭代查询过程中,每次只向其他 DNS 服务器查询一次,直到获得最终的 IP 地址或者得到指向下一个 DNS 服务器的指引,然后将结果逐步返回给客户端,由客户端继续向其他 DNS 服务器查询,直到获得完整的解析结果。
4、返回解析结果:一旦本地 DNS 服务器获得了域名对应的 IP 地址,它会将结果返回给用户浏览器,浏览器随后根据该 IP 地址与目标服务器建立连接,获取所需的网络资源。
(二)负载均衡与冗余备份
为了确保 DNS 服务的高可用性和性能,西安电信通常会采用多台 DNS 服务器组成集群,并进行负载均衡配置,这样,当大量用户同时发起域名解析请求时,可以将请求均匀分配到不同的 DNS 服务器上进行处理,避免单台服务器过载,通过冗余备份机制,即使其中一台或多台 DNS 服务器出现故障,其他正常的服务器也能够继续提供服务,保证域名解析服务的连续性和稳定性。
五、西安电信 DNS 的优化策略
(一)合理配置本地 DNS
用户可以根据自身的网络环境和需求,选择合适的西安电信 DNS 服务器地址进行配置,可以通过网络连接属性设置中的“Internet 协议版本 4(TCP/IPv4)”或“Internet 协议版本 6(TCP/IPv6)”选项,手动指定首选和备用 DNS 服务器地址,要确保本地网络设备(如路由器、光猫等)的 DNS 设置正确,避免因错误的 DNS 配置导致网络连接问题。
(二)定期更新 DNS 缓存
由于域名与 IP 地址的对应关系可能会发生变化,因此定期清理本地计算机和网络设备的 DNS 缓存是非常必要的,在 Windows 系统中,可以通过命令提示符输入“ipconfig /flushdns”命令来清除 DNS 缓存;在 Linux 系统中,可以使用“sudo systemctl restart networkmanager”命令重启网络管理器以清空缓存,这样可以确保下次访问网站时能够获取到最新的 IP 地址信息,避免因缓存过期导致的访问错误。
(三)监控与维护 DNS 服务器
西安电信需要加强对其 DNS 服务器的监控与维护工作,通过实时监测服务器的性能指标(如 CPU 利用率、内存使用率、网络流量等),及时发现并解决潜在的硬件故障或性能瓶颈问题,定期对服务器软件进行更新和安全漏洞修复,防止黑客攻击和恶意篡改,确保 DNS 服务的安全性和可靠性。
六、相关问题与解答
(一)如何判断当前使用的是否是西安电信 DNS?
答:可以通过多种方法来判断,在 Windows 系统中,打开命令提示符,输入“ipconfig /all”命令,查看“DNS Servers”后面的 IP 地址列表,其中如果有显示类似“218.29.40.101”“218.29.40.102”等西安电信常用的 DNS 服务器地址,则说明当前使用的是西安电信 DNS,在 Mac OS X 系统中,点击“系统偏好设置” “网络”,选择当前连接的网络(如 WiFi),点击“高级”,再选择“DNS”,即可查看当前使用的 DNS 服务器地址,也可以通过在线工具(如 IP 地址查询网站)查询本地网络的出口 IP 地址所属的运营商,如果是西安电信,那么很可能正在使用其提供的 DNS 服务。
(二)如果西安电信 DNS 出现故障,应该怎么办?
答:如果怀疑西安电信 DNS 出现故障,首先可以尝试刷新本地计算机或设备的 DNS 缓存(如前文所述),如果问题仍然存在,可以尝试更换其他可靠的公共 DNS 服务器,如 Google Public DNS(8.8.8.8 和 8.8.4.4)、阿里云公共 DNS(223.5.5.5 和 223.6.6.6)等,在更换公共 DNS 后,再次测试网络连接是否正常,如果仍然无法解决问题,可能是本地网络存在其他故障或限制,建议联系西安电信客服或专业的网络技术人员进行进一步排查和解决。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/188591.html